A contigent of ten basketballers from Tobago will travel to St Kitts and Nevis from Friday and return three days later during which they will play a series of matches against teams from the island's Premier Division and Division A teams.
Along with the players, head coach Vincent Taylor, assistant coach Ronnie Ryan, Johnan Roberts, the team's trainer and Strisand Murray, the team manager will make the trip.
The team's visit is part of the Department of Sport Development Programme, which is geared at allowing athletes international exposure which will ensure that they take their game to a higher level. The team's visit has been made possible through the vision of Assemblyman Jomo Pitt who works with all sporting organisations with the view to developing and nurturing the talents of the Tobago athlete.
The traveling players include, Jerel Orr, Sylon Williams, Kerry Celestine, Randell Moore, Myles Sampson, Valdez Perez, Lenwayne Wallace, Richard Alleyne, Allister Roachford and Shorn Solomon.
